Clinton Garrison Obituary

Clinton Leon Garrison, 56, of Springfield, Ohio, passed away on May 22, 2026. He was born on April 9, 1970, Clinton was a father, grandfather, brother, uncle, and friend whose presence brought laughter, strength, and love to those around him.

Clinton was a man who truly enjoyed life’s simple pleasures. He loved spending time fishing, watching WWE wrestling, detailing cars until they shined, and listening to old school music that always seemed to set his mood. 

He leaves behind his six beloved children: Kelsey Wilcoxen and Tayla Garrison, both of Springfield, Ohio; Aaliyah Garrison and Clinton Garrison II, both of Dayton, Ohio; and Maetayvion Garrison and Ra’khia Garrison, both of Springfield, Ohio. Clinton also leaves to cherish his memory, his grandchildren, Talia Johnson, Aamiyah Bullock, Hakeem Bullock Jr, and one soon to be born grandson.

He is also survived by his siblings Sylvia Garrison-Taylor, Janet Garrison, Nathaniel Garrison and Natasha Garrison; his aunt, Lucreta Garrison Summers of Austell, Georgia; along with a host of nieces, nephews, cousins, and close friends who will forever cherish his memory.  

Clinton was preceded in death by his mother, Estella Yvonne Garrison.

Though his passing leaves a tremendous void, the memories he created and the love he shared will remain forever in the hearts of all who knew him. 

Until we meet again.....
